Web12 de abr. de 2024 · Your question concerns using Nystatin for an oral fungal infection (thrush). How Is Nystatin Dosed For Thrush? Nystatin suspension should be dosed at 400,000 to 600,000 units (4 to 6 mL), swished in the mouth four times daily (every 6 hours or so), for at least one to two minutes for 7 to 14 days. The same dose is given to infants, ... The active ingredient in NILSTAT Oral Drops is nystatin. Each 1mL contains 100,000 units of nystatin. WebDosage for nystatin liquid. The usual dose (for adults, babies and children) to: treat oral thrush is 1ml, taken 4 times a day. Leave at least 3 hours between doses. If your doctor recommends something different, follow their advice. prevent oral thrush is 1ml, taken once or twice a day; How to take nystatin liquid
